  • The Assumption Gap — What Dermatology Practices Think Patients Understand (But Don't)
    Dec 23 2025

    This episode of The Distinctive Dermatologist is about something that quietly affects patient trust, loyalty, and outcomes far more than most dermatology practices realize. It's something I call the assumption gap — and it may be one of the most expensive blind spots in healthcare.

    The assumption gap is the space between what we think patients understand… and what they actually understand.

    When we assume understanding, confusion quietly replaces confidence. That's why this matters so much.

  • The December Trap: Being Busy Is Not the Same as Being Productive
    Dec 2 2025

    For most dermatology practices, it's one of the busiest times of the year. People are trying to use those remaining benefits, deductibles are about to reset, and suddenly, everything patients postponed over the past 11 months becomes urgent.

    It's a sprint. And because it's a sprint, there's a myth that creeps into a lot of practices. Here it is:

    "If we're busy in December… we must be productive."

    But let's be honest — busy and productive are not the same thing. Not even close. That's why the goal of this episode is to help your practice avoid the "December trap." Even though December is busy from a clinical standpoint, it's often quieter from a strategic perspective.

    We'll discuss why December isn't just a finish line. It's a preview of what needs strengthening for the year ahead.
